INQUIRIES AT WINGATUI ,

You Beauty (G. E. Lowry) stifled himself in the Trial Handicap at Wingatui on Sjaturday, and had to be destroyed. x

D. N. Hadfield was fined £.lO for engaging to ride two horses in the President’s Handicap.

Joydy threw up her head in the preliminary for the President’s Handicap, and injured her rider. R. J. Pledger, who was sent to hospital suffering from abrasions to the face and concussion.

Joydy was withdrawn from the race, and investments were refunded.
